Innovations in Extruded Bricks
- Sustainable Manufacturing Processes
With growing environmental concerns, manufacturers are implementing eco-friendly practices. This includes using alternative fuels, reducing carbon emissions, and recycling waste materials in brick production. The shift toward energy-efficient kilns and solar-powered operations is also gaining traction. Traditional clay-based bricks are now being enhanced with new composite materials. The integration of fly ash, recycled glass, and other industrial by-products helps in reducing dependency on virgin raw materials while improving the strength and insulation properties of extruded bricks. - Precision Engineering & Automation
Robotics and artificial intelligence (AI) are transforming brick manufacturing. Automated extrusion processes ensure uniformity in size and shape, reducing waste and increasing production efficiency. The concept of smart bricks is revolutionizing the industry. These bricks can have embedded sensors to monitor structural integrity, temperature, and humidity levels, making them ideal for modern smart buildings. This innovation enhances building safety and performance. - Customization & Aesthetic Enhancements

Emerging Technologies in the Brick Industry
- 3D Printing & Modular Construction
3D printing technology is being integrated with traditional brick manufacturing, allowing for the creation of intricate designs and complex structures with minimal material wastage. This technology enhances construction speed and precision. - Nano-Coated & Self-Cleaning Bricks
Nano-coatings can be applied to extruded bricks to make them self-cleaning and resistant to pollutants. This technology improves the longevity of buildings and reduces maintenance costs. - Lightweight and High-Performance Bricks
Researchers are developing lightweight extruded bricks that maintain strength while reducing overall construction weight. This is particularly beneficial for high-rise structures and earthquake-prone areas. - AI-Driven Quality Control
Artificial intelligence is being used to monitor and control the quality of bricks in real time. AI algorithms can detect defects during the extrusion process, ensuring consistent quality and reducing wastage.
